Hi Georgie,
 
Taylor and I attended the Turnbuckle Promotions show at the Bucks County Sheraton yesterday and had a wonderful time. The show got off to a late start due to the weather being crappy and flights being delayed which is completely understandable because unless your God we can't control the weather. And despite the crappy weather, all the talent showed up as advertised which is a feat in itself. The room was setup with talent sitting along the walls with VIP tickets going first. As far as talent went there was someone for everyone old school and new school. My convention standouts, favorites, are Midajah and Scott Steiner. They stood up for the photo opt and made sure everything we had got signed the way we wanted them. They were a total joy to visit with. Goldberg was the top draw and had a long line and remembered me and Taylor from the San Fran convention last year. Tommy Rich was very nice and was great seeing him again. Heidenreich and Lance Storm were both awesome and couldn't do enough for you. Jeff Jarret was equally wonderful as we chatted a little about TNA and how Hulk Hogan almost joined the company a few years back and the whole guitar Japan angle. Stacy Carter was a bit late to the signing due to a luggage problem but was very cool too and was happy to be there. Rocky Johnson still looks like he could go an hour in the ring and was in good spirits. As far as vendor talent went all very nice, Rick Steiner sat next to ODB and were very cool. Jimmy Snuka sat next to Rocky Johnson and Jimmy was very pleasant to visit with. I want to take a moment to thank Jason Blaustein for a putting on a great convention despite the crappy weather and airline delaysalong with a few more obstacles Jason went above and beyond the call of duty for me and Taylor and his kindness will never be forgotten.
 
Ray and Taylor Dutczak - Yonkers NY
